Rules[edit]

Place a digit from 1 to 9 into each cell of the grid so that same digits do not touch each other, even diagonally. Every digit must have all the digits that are smaller than itself in the eight neighbouring cells, including diagonal ones.

History of the puzzle[edit]

First appeared on OAPC 9 (2009). [1] In the IB, Mehmet Murat Sevim (Turkey) is credited as the originator of this puzzle idea.
